What are some common challenges faced by RPC (Remote Procedure Call) developers when integrating services across distributed systems?

RPC developers often encounter challenges related to network reliability, latency, and error handling when connecting services across distributed systems. Ensuring consistent data serialization, maintaining backward compatibility during service updates, and managing security protocols are also key concerns. Collaborating closely with backend, DevOps, and security teams is essential to address these issues and ensure smooth communication between microservices or external APIs.

What are RPCs (Remote Procedure Calls) in computing?

RPCs, or Remote Procedure Calls, are a protocol that allows a program to execute a procedure (function) on another computer as if it were a local call. This enables distributed computing and simplifies communication between different systems or services. RPC abstracts the communication process, so developers do not need to manage the underlying network details. They are widely used in client-server architectures to request services from remote servers.

Fusion/ODF is a Windows-based low-level device platform software component installed on millions of HP devices to enable connectivity, telemetry, and more modern AI or subscription use cases.

The platform is modular and event-based while modernizing the HP App Enabling Services driver. The platform is designed with a strong reusability and platform mindset, where most code features are implemented as shared services/libraries for Windows both x64 and arm64, and most business features are developed as modules, all for reusability across the HP portfolio Further, it is used as an enabler for the new AI PCs portfolio for performing local inference and more.

This role operates within HP's evolving platform, and service-oriented operating model, ensuring that architectural direction, AI platform, and cloud solutions align with shared platforms, service ownership models, and cross-organizational priorities.
